Salinas council accepts FY24 midyear budget review; staff urges early start on Measure G renewal

City staff presented a FY24 midyear financial review, recommended roughly $727,000 in limited midyear appropriations and warned the council that, without extension of local revenue measure G by 2030–31, the city faces a significant multi‑year shortfall. Council approved the midyear adjustments.

The Salinas City Council received the fiscal year 2024 midyear budget review and approved a set of limited midyear appropriations and budget adjustments recommended by finance staff.

Finance Director Selena Andrews and Acting Assistant Finance Director A. Pedroza presented the report. Staff said operating revenues and expenditures are tracking near expectations through the first half of the fiscal year but highlighted that a multi‑year forecast shows a sizeable structural shortfall if Measure G is not extended beyond fiscal year 2030–31.
